Thai Yellow Curry with Glass Noodles

What is Namjai Paste?


Namjai paste is a key ingredient in many Thai dishes. It is made from spices and herbs like turmeric, lemongrass, galangal, and chili. These components give the curry its characteristic yellow color and wonderful aroma. By using Namjai paste, you simplify the cooking process while ensuring a taste that feels authentic.

Ingredients You'll Need


To make this delicious Thai yellow curry with glass noodles, gather these ingredients:


  • 2 tablespoons Namjai paste

  • 1 can (400ml) coconut milk

  • 1 cup vegetable or chicken broth

  • 200g glass noodles

  • 1 cup mixed vegetables (like bell peppers, carrots, and snap peas)

  • 1 tablespoon fish sauce (or soy sauce for a vegetarian option)

  • Fresh basil and cilantro for garnish

  • Lime wedges for serving


Cooking Instructions


  1. Prepare the Glass Noodles: Soak the glass noodles in warm water for about 15-20 minutes until they soften. Drain and set aside.


  2. Make the Curry Base: In a large pot, heat a tablespoon of oil over medium heat. Add the Namjai paste and sauté it for about 2 minutes until fragrant. This step is vital for unlocking the full flavor of the spices.


  3. Add Coconut Milk and Broth: Pour in the coconut milk and vegetable or chicken broth, stirring well. Bring this mixture to a gentle simmer, allowing the flavors to combine.


  4. Incorporate Vegetables: Add the mixed vegetables to the pot and cook for 5-7 minutes, ensuring they remain tender yet crisp. You’ll love how the bright colors make the dish more appealing.


  5. Combine with Glass Noodles: Next, add the soaked glass noodles and the fish sauce. Stir well and let it simmer for another 2-3 minutes to meld the flavors together.


  6. Serve and Garnish: Ladle the curry into bowls and top with fresh basil and cilantro. Don’t forget to serve with lime wedges for a refreshing kick!


Why You’ll Love This Dish


This Thai yellow curry with glass noodles is not just delicious; it's also highly adaptable. You can easily personalize it by adding proteins like chicken, shrimp, or tofu. Did you know that adding chicken can increase the protein content to approximately 30 grams per serving? The creamy coconut milk balances the spiciness of the Namjai paste, offering a perfectly harmonious flavor.
